请问这个程序怎么理解?

这是二分频的程序,就是输入一个频率输出输入端频率的二分之,程序如下:
NETWORK1
A  I  0.0
AN  M  10.0
O
AN  I  0.0
A  Q  4.0
=  Q  4.0
NETWORK2
AN  I  0.0
A  Q  4.0
O
A  I  0.0
A  M  10.0
=  M  10.0
看不懂,Q4.0,和M10.0怎么自锁呢?

最佳答案

plc在扫描循环周期开始时先将过程映像输出区的数据输出到数字量输出模块,并将输入模块的信息读取到过程映像输入区,过程映像区更新完后就开始运行用户程序。
按下I0.0,Q4.0=1;M10.0为0。松开I0.0时,plc首先扫描I0.0=0,Q4.0=1,故通过I0.0的长闭自锁,Q4.0=1。I0.0的长闭和Q4.0接通M10.0=1。当第二次按下I0.0时候由于M10.0=1,Q4.0通过I0.0长闭断开,Q4.0为0;而I0.0和M10.0自锁,M10.0=1。松开I0.0时,由于M10.0=1故Q4.0=0;后线圈M10.0通过I0.0长开断开。

提问者对于答案的评价:
谢谢了大哥!

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c241906.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2018年12月1日
下一篇 2018年12月1日

相关推荐